Alarm.com Holdings, Inc. reported 2018 financial results today. Overall the company's long term financial model is characterised by the following facts:
- Alarm.com Holdings, Inc. is a fast growth stock: 2018 revenue growth was 24.1%, 5 year revenue CAGR was 26.4% at 2018 ROIC 4.0%
- Alarm.com Holdings, Inc. has low CAPEX intensity: 5 year average CAPEX/Revenue was 3.1%. At the same time it's a lot of higher than industry average of 13.3%.
- CAPEX is quite volatile: $0m in 2018, $10m in 2017, $9m in 2016, $10m in 2015, $7m in 2014
- In the last 5 years the company invested considerably less than D&A: $37m vs. $59m. In 2018 this situation was still the same: CAPEX was 0 while D&A was 23
- The company has potentially unprofitable business model: ROIC is 4.0%

Revenue and profitability
The company's Revenue surged on 24.1%. Revenue growth showed acceleration in 18Q4 - it increased 25.5% YoY. Revenue growth was financed by EBITDA margin decline. EBITDA Margin decreased on 7.1 pp from 15.4% to 8.3% in 2018.
Gross Margin showed almost no change in 2018. Gross Margin stuck to a growing trend at 1.4 pp per annum in 2014-2018. SG&A as a % of Revenue increased on 6.9 pp from 29.2% to 36.1% in 2018. Stock Based Compensation (SBC) as a % of Revenue increased slightly on 1.0 pp from 2.2% to 3.2% in 2018. During the last 5 years SBC as a % of Revenue bottomed in 2016 at 1.5% and was growing since that time.
Net Income margin decreased on 3.5 pp from 8.6% to 5.1% in 2018.
Investments (CAPEX, working capital and M&A)
Accounts receivable as a % of Revenue showed almost no change in 2018. Inventories as a % of Revenue increased slightly on 1.3 pp from 4.2% to 5.5% in 2018.
Return on investment
The company operates at low ROIC (4.0%) and ROE (8.4%). ROIC dropped on 10.2 pp from 14.2% to 4.0% in 2018. ROE decreased on 5.4 pp from 13.8% to 8.4% in 2018.
Leverage (Debt)
Debt level is -2.3x Net Debt / EBITDA and 1.9x Debt / EBITDA. Debt decreased on 5.6% while cash surged on 51.6%.
Alarm.com Holdings, Inc. has good short term financial stability: Interest coverage ratio (ICR) is 4.2x. The company has no short term refinancing risk: short term debt is zero.
Average interest expence paid by the company was 4.4% in 2018.
Valuation and dividends
Alarm.com Holdings, Inc.'s trades at EV/EBITDA 77.3x and P/E 128.8x.
Management team
Stephen S Trundle "Steve" is a the company's CEO. Stephen S Trundle "Steve" is a founder and has spent 16 years with the company. CEO total compensation was
$1,941,144 in 2018 which included
$210,000 salary. Alarm.com Holdings, Inc.'s CFO Steve Valenzuela has spent 2 years with the company.
Insider ownership is 7.3%. Insider ownership didn't change in 2018.
At the end of financial year the company had 844 employees. The number of employees increased on 7.7%. Average revenue per employee in 2018 was
$498,216 and it surged on 15.2%.
